Wednesday, October 30, 2024 / Categories: Featured, Leisure, Civic Responsibility Dani Walsh - Supervisor, Bloomfield Township, Michigan Current and future state of the Township Dani Walsh, current Supervisor of the Charter Township of Bloomfield Hills, Michigan joins Henry to discuss a myriad of issues effecting the residents of the community. Topics of discussion range from trends and forecasting, technology, safety, services, Board relations, and the budget. Bloomfield Township is similar to many communities throughout the state and country whose demographics include a large population of seniors, and those aging in place.
